Coworker Quote by Tsoknyi Rinpoche

“Practicing discipline involves continually working to find space in our patterns, to find the gaps in the images we hold about ourselves. It also means finding the gaps in our ideas about others, releasing images that we hold about a manager, a coworker, a friend, or a partner.” quote by Tsoknyi Rinpoche
